I just finished this scenario, and that last fight I came out of with zero losses vs. about 200 Glories and 50 or so Blazing Glories.
I specced for Life Drain and Mass Life Drain, as well as putting Storm Arrows on the Skellies and the occasional Disruption to drop their defense. I also discovered that the healing from the Ghosts/Specters is stronger than one might think, especially when they are present in numbers, so I tended to wait a turn or two before using one of their two heals. I also made sure to use it while the Ghouls were in melee, for that extra handful of kills.
Life Drain on a hard-hitting melee stack is <span class="ev_code_RED">
INSANE</span>. I was getting back 10-15 Ghouls per strike, which, coupled with Necromancy spam and the occasional heal from the Specters (in hindsight I should have split them into 2-3 stacks for better coverage), let them just keep on killing with no losses. Had to heal the Specters twice and the Skellies once, due to initiative issues letting the opposition get additional strikes.
Storm Arrows is pretty good too, the Skellies were killing (most of) a stack per volley which took a goodly bit of pressure off the Ghouls.
